Safety Tips
It is always wise to practice safe street smarts when navigating the city.
Basic Street Smarts:
- Create an itinerary before you leave
- Provide someone (who is not with you) with accurate details of where you’re going, when you’ll be back and your cell phone number
- Walk with a friend or group
- Stay alert and tuned into your surroundings (Turn off your iPod!)
- Stick to well traveled streets. Avoid shortcuts through parking lots and alleys
- Keep your wallet/money in an inside, front pocket, not a back pocket
- Do not wear shoes or clothing that restrict your movements
- Bring back-up cab fare
- Adopt a no-nonsense attitude (city face)
- In an emergency, call 911 and Lake Forest College Security at 847-735-5555
On Buses and Subways:
- Use well-lighted, busy stops
- Stay alert - Do not doze or daydream
- Maintain personal space
- Watch who gets off with you - If you feel uneasy, walk directly to a place where there are other people
- Stay alert and tuned into your surroundings (Turn of your iPod!)
- Avoid traveling alone late at night or early in the morning
- Trust your instincts!
